* | Makefile: Git dependency, take 3Lars Hjemli2008-08-061-5/+3
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| In commit a1266edfe the build instructions for the git libs where moved to their real targets, which in turn depended on the phony target `git`. But since `git` is an actual directory in cgit the git libs wouldn't be recompiled when needed. So with this patch (third time lucky), cgit is declared to depend on the really phony target `libgit` and the build instructions for `libgit` is to unconditionally rebuild git/libgit.a and git/xdiff/lib.a. Signed-off-by: Lars Hjemli <hjemli@gmail.com>

| * Makefile: autobuild dependency rulesLars Hjemli2008-03-241-1/+10
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| This uses gcc to generate dependency rules for each `.o` file, based on the corresponding `.c` file, into a new set of `.d` files (which are also defined to depend on the same set of source files as their `.o` files). Result: * all objectfile dependencies are correctly calculated * only the necessary dependencies are recalculated when a sourcefile is updated Inspiration for the build rules: * http://www.gnu.org/software/make/manual/make.html#Automatic-Prerequisites * http://make.paulandlesley.org/autodep.html Signed-off-by: Lars Hjemli <hjemli@gmail.com>

* Add caching infrastructureLars Hjemli2006-12-101-2/+4
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| This enables internal caching of page output. Page requests are split into four groups: 1) repo listing (front page) 2) repo summary 3) repo pages w/symbolic references in query string 4) repo pages w/constant sha1's in query string Each group has a TTL specified in minutes. When a page is requested, a cached filename is stat(2)'ed and st_mtime is compared to time(2). If TTL has expired (or the file didn't exist), the cached file is regenerated. When generating a cached file, locking is used to avoid parallell processing of the request. If multiple processes tries to aquire the same lock, the ones who fail to get the lock serves the (expired) cached file. If the cached file don't exist, the process instead calls sched_yield(2) before restarting the request processing. Signed-off-by: Lars Hjemli <hjemli@gmail.com>
